Role Description

Dropbox powers collaboration and cloud infrastructure for over 700 million registered users worldwide. We’re building the next generation of scalable storage, distributed compute, large-scale content processing, and secure infrastructure, with AI/ML workloads top-of-mind.

As a PhD Systems & AI/ML Research Intern, you’ll work on meaningful infrastructure problems at the intersection of distributed systems, backend services, and AI/ML workloads. Supported by senior engineers, you’ll own a project aligned with your research, that results in a working prototype with the goal of a submission for adoption internally and external publication. Come help us define and build the infra layer for our next-gen products.

Responsibilities
  • Execute a defined engineering/research project aligned with your research.
  • Implement a prototype that addresses a concrete infrastructure or AI-systems challenge.
  • Build and run benchmarks using realistic workloads to measure performance, reliability, or security improvements.
  • Document the design and implementation, including assumptions, architecture, tradeoffs, and evaluation results.
  • Deliver a final artifact that includes a working prototype, reproducible results, technical write-up, and internal presentation.
  • Collaborate with mentors to refine the approach, validate results, and, if appropriate, prepare findings for internal adoption or external publication.
Requirements
  • PhD candidate in Computer Science or a related field graduating between Winter 2026 and Spring 2028.
  • Proven experience in systems/infrastructure and/or AI/ML through research publications, significant projects, or internships where you built or tested advanced solutions.
  • Strong coding skills (e.g., Python, Rust, Go, C++) plus an ability to quickly prototype and iterate on cutting-edge ideas.
  • Curiosity and drive to explore novel systems methodologies and translate them into practical applications that solve practical needs.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ills, especially in interdisciplinary teams.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
